Rachael McNutt is a Washington, D.C.–based actor working in theatre, film, and television with a strong background in physicality and improvisation. Working professionally from NYC to DC, she has trained with and befriended some of the best in the industry. She looks forward to telling your stories with her own vigor.
​
Rachael is a versatile performer with a deep love for classical text. Her favorite roles include Miranda in The Tempest and Peter Quince in A Midsummer Night’s Dream. She is also a director, most proud of her work directing The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Night-Time, where she also served as the intimacy coordinator and fight choreographer. She highly values collaboration and strives to bring authenticity and emotional truth to every performance.
​
Beyond her acting career, Rachael is a licensed Emergency Medical Technician (EMT). She serves her community with care and empathy when it matters most. Additionally, she has been teaching and coaching young theatre artists at StageCoach Theatre Company for several years. She hopes to guide and inspire young performers as they find their way in the work.
